The Wearever Carpet Company manufactures two brands of carpet-shag and sculptured-in 100-yard lots. It requires 8 hours to produce one lot of shag carpet and 6 hours to produce one lot of sculptured carpet. The company has the following production goals, in prioritized order:
(1) Do not underutilize production capacity, which is 480 hours.
(2) Achieve product demand of 40 (100-yard) lots for shag and 50 (100-yard) lots for sculptured carpet. Meeting demand for shag is more important than meeting demand for sculptured, by a ratio of 5 to 2.
(3) Limit production overtime to 20 hours.
a. Formulate a goal programming model to determine the amount of shag and sculptured carpet to produce to best meet the company's goals.
b. Solve this model by using the computer.
